About Minecraft Saves

Minecraft uses gzip-compressed NBT (Named Binary Tag) format for world and player data. Our editor auto-decompresses the gzip layer and analyzes the binary NBT data. JSON-based datapacks and configs are also fully supported.

Save File Locations

🪟
Windows

%AppData%\.minecraft\saves\<WorldName>\level.dat

🍎
macOS

~/Library/Application Support/minecraft/saves/<WorldName>/level.dat

🐧
Linux

~/.minecraft/saves/<WorldName>/level.dat

Java Edition uses NBT format. Bedrock Edition saves are at %LocalAppData%/Packages/Microsoft.MinecraftUWP_8wekyb3d8bbwe/LocalState/games/com.mojang/minecraftWorlds/.

File format: NBT (gzip compressed) / JSON | Extension: .dat / .json
